When an agonist activates GIP receptors, it improves insulin secretion and will increase glucose reuptake. These actions decrease blood glucose stages, contributing to weight administration and sort 2 diabetes administration.
Phase I and II clinical trials corroborate these findings, demonstrating dose-dependent weight loss, reductions in Glycated Hemoglobin (HbA1c) ranges, and enhancements in liver steatosis and diabetic kidney condition. Common adverse effects are mainly gastrointestinal and dose-similar. Ongoing Section III trials, like the TRIUMPH scientific tests, intention to even further Consider retatrutide’s prolonged-time period protection and efficacy in varied individual populations. Another study by Ma et al. aimed to compare the effects of retatrutide, liraglutide, and tirzepatide on diabetic kidney condition in db/db mice [41]. The seven-week-previous male C57BL/KSJ diabetic db/db and db/m mice have been housed in an ambient temperature of 21 ± 2 °C and humidity of 45 ± 10%, maintained below a 12 h light/dark cycle. At 8 months of age, the mice were randomly divided into five teams (Each individual n = six): db/m, db/db, db/db + Lira, db/db + Tirz, and db/db + Reta. Each individual treatment team was divided into two cages with a few mice in Just about every cage. The mice in db/db + Lira, db/db + Tirz, and db/db + Reta teams gained day-to-day subcutaneous injections of 10 nmol/kg of liraglutide, tirzepatide, and retatrutide for 10 months, respectively. The db/m and db/db teams were given an equal quantity of saline intraperitoneally more than exactly the same time. The dose from the drug was adjusted weekly throughout the analyze period of time based upon alterations while in the weight in the mice. Weekly, a glucometer was used to evaluate the fasting blood glucose (FBG) stages. HbA1c values have been measured originally and conclusion on the experiment. After a period of 10 months, urine samples have been collected from separately housed mice in metabolic cages above a 24 h period, accompanied by recording of urine volumes and storage at −80 °C for further more Examination.
